Scott Homer Drew (born October 23, 1970) is an American college basketball coach who is the head coach of the Baylor Bears, a position he has held since 2003.. Drew began his coaching career as an assistant for Valparaiso under his father Homer Drew.Following his father's retirement in 2002, Drew would serve as the head coach of Valparaiso for one season before being hired by Baylor in 2003. Scott Drew began as a graduate assistant at Valparaiso, moved up to a full-time assistant position, developed a reputation as one of college basketball's top recruiters, replaced Homer as Valparaiso's head coach, won theregular-season conference championship and then, in the summer of 2003, had to decide whether accepting the open position at Baylor would make or break his blossoming career.
